ICT Fire & Rescue Overview Who We Are ICT Fire & Rescue is a private emergency response training and rescue organization based in Kenya, dedicated to addressing the critical gaps in disaster preparedness and response. With a focus on saving lives, protecting livelihoods, and strengthening communities, ICT Fire & Rescue serves as a cornerstone for building resilience in a region prone to both natural and man-made disasters. Our Mission To empower individuals, communities, and institutions with lifesaving skills and resources while fostering a culture of preparedness and proactive disaster management. Challenges We Address Kenya’s disaster management landscape is marked by: Inadequate firefighting equipment. Limited access to trained personnel. Poor community awareness and engagement in disaster response. Traffic congestion and infrastructure challenges during emergencies. Lack of toll-free emergency response lines. ICT Fire & Rescue steps in to bridge these gaps by providing modern training programs, cutting-edge equipment, and effective coordination with local governments and communities. Key Services Emergency Response Training: Offering comprehensive training with modern equipment and certified instructors. Disaster Awareness Campaigns: Educating the public about fire safety, disaster prevention, and response techniques. Emergency Services: Rapid response teams equipped to handle fires, floods, and medical emergencies. Partnerships: Collaborating with county governments, institutions, and organizations to strengthen localized disaster management systems. Impact Saving Lives: Training individuals to act swiftly and effectively in emergencies. Reducing Property Damage: Quick and skilled response mitigates losses during disasters. Building Resilience: Promoting a proactive approach to disaster preparedness within communities. Supporting Food Security: Protecting Kenya’s agricultural heartland by reducing wildfire risks and enhancing disaster response mechanisms
